Technical field
The utility model relates to section bar field, particularly relates to a kind of Novel hydroelectric line section bar.
Background technique
The internal structure of existing production line section bar, there is lateral cross section structure as shown in Figure 1 more, namely the stiffening rib of its inside is criss-crossing reinforcing ribs 1, the interior separation of section bar is four cavitys 2 by criss-crossing reinforcing ribs 1, because these section bars are all by extruded, in extruded process, criss-crossing reinforcing ribs 1 easily deforms.

Refer to Fig. 2, the utility model is embodiment comprise:
A kind of Novel hydroelectric line section bar, comprise: body, described body is provided with the cross section structure of rectangle, described rectangle comprises first side 11 adjacent successively, second side 12, 3rd side 13 and four side 14, two first stiffening ribs 2 are provided with between described second side 12 and four side 14, described two first stiffening ribs 2 are parallel to each other, and described first stiffening rib 21 is parallel to each other with described first side 11, the interior separation of rectangle is three cavitys 31 by two described first stiffening ribs 21, described first side 11, second side 12, 3rd side 13 and four side 14 are all provided with multiple installation notch 15 for installing conveyor belt.
Described installation notch 15 is provided with circular arc cutaway, and one end of described first stiffening rib 21 is fixedly connected on the installation notch 15 of second side 12, and the other end is fixedly connected on the installation notch 15 of four side 14.
Described rectangle is also provided with multiple second stiffening rib 22, described second stiffening rib 22 is fixedly connected between the first stiffening rib 21 and described installation notch 15.
Described rectangle is also provided with multiple 3rd stiffening rib 23, described 3rd stiffening rib 23 is fixedly connected between adjacent two described installation notches 15.
Described second stiffening rib 22 and the 3rd stiffening rib 23 are all provided with a square hole 24.
As shown in Figure 2, first side 11 and the 3rd side 13 are all provided with two installation notches 15, second side 12 and four side 14 are all provided with four installation notches 15, rectangle is separated into three adjacent cavitys 31 by two first stiffening ribs 21, simultaneously, four the second stiffening ribs 22 and four the 3rd stiffening ribs 23 are provided with in this rectangle, first stiffening rib 22 is parallel to each other, and be parallel to each other with first side 11, change stiffening rib in prior art and intersect the structure of (criss-crossing reinforcing ribs), make section bar in the process of extruding production, not easily deform.And not only structure is simple for this structure of the first stiffening rib 21 be parallel to each other, the materials'use cost that under the same terms of equality strength, equal bearing capacity, equal volume, the production line section bar weight in the present embodiment is lighter, reduce section bar, improves productivity effect.
